Veronica Johnny is a Cree-Metis/Dene multi-disciplinary, 2-Spirit, artist-entrepreneur and arts educator. Ms. Johnny is a member of the Athabasca Chipewyan First Nation and presently lives in Ontario, Canada.
Veronica founded The Johnnys, a multi-award nominated rock’n’roll band, with partner Dave Johnny. The Johnnys released their 4th album, Leathers and Feathers in June 2020. She’s the rhythm guitarist, lead singer and band manager.
In 2020 & 2021, their singles, Nisakihtan Kiya Kisoskatowin and Leathers and Feathers (Salas/Gutierrez Remix) both climbed to the Top 10 on the Indigenous Music Countdown!
As a singer-songwriter, at Veronica Johnny Music, she mixes acoustic guitar with hard rock and hand drum rhythms. She’s an Indigenous Woman Entrepreneur, engineer, producer, manager, musician, artist, digital storyteller, hand drummer and singer.
Veronica also offers virtual and in-person workshops and events through her Indigenous arts education business called IndigenEd.
